Interest Expense for Purposes of IRC § 163(j)
Anti-Avoidance Rule
Interest expense includes:
• Any otherwise deductible expense or loss
for an amount predominantly incurred in
consideration of the time value of money,
• Incurred in a transaction or series of
integrated or related transactions, and
• In which the taxpayer secures the use of
funds for a period of time.
• Prop. Treas. Reg. § 1.163(j)-1(b)(20)(iv)
